Preparation time: 10 minutes
Cooking time: 15 minutes
Total time: 25 minutes
Servings: 2
Ingredients:
- 3 medium potatoes
- 2 eggs
- 3 tablespoons grated cheese (preferably salty cheese or cottage cheese)
- 4 green or black olives (depending on preferences)
- 2 slices of melted cheese
- 2 tablespoons vegetable oil (olive oil adds extra flavor)
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- Ketchup, for serving
- Pickles, to accompany the omelette
Preparing the potato omelette:
1. Preparing the potatoes: Start by peeling the 3 medium potatoes. Wash them well under cold water to remove any impurities. Use a large grater to grate the potatoes. They will add a pleasant texture to your omelette.
2. Frying the potatoes: In a non-stick skillet, add the 2 tablespoons of oil and heat it over medium heat. Add the grated potatoes and fry them for about 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until they become golden and crispy. Make sure not to leave them too long to avoid burning.
3. Preparing the eggs: In a bowl, beat the 2 eggs with a little salt and pepper, according to your taste. Add the 3 tablespoons of grated cheese and the sliced olives. This combination will give the omelette a rich and salty flavor.
4. Combining the ingredients: Once the potatoes are fried, pour the egg mixture over the potatoes in the skillet. Use a spatula to ensure the eggs cover the potatoes evenly. Cover the skillet with a lid and let the omelette cook for 5-7 minutes, until the eggs are fully cooked.
5. Flipping the omelette: Here comes an essential trick: to flip the omelette, you can use the lid. This will allow you to flip it without breaking. With the help of a spatula, gently loosen the edges of the omelette, then place the lid over the skillet and quickly flip them. Cook the other side for another 3-5 minutes.
6. Serving the omelette: Once the omelette is well cooked, add the 2 slices of melted cheese on top and let them melt slightly. Serve the omelette warm, alongside ketchup and pickles for a pleasant contrast of flavors.
Practical tips:
- Choosing the potatoes: Opt for potatoes that have a higher starch content, such as those for mashing, to achieve a better texture.
- Cheese: You can experiment with different types of cheese, such as feta or mozzarella, depending on your preferences.
- Olives: Replace olives with roasted red peppers or sautéed mushrooms for a different and tasty variation.
- Vegan option: For a vegan version, you can use tofu instead of eggs and plant-based cheese.

Frequently asked questions:
- Can I add other ingredients?
Absolutely! You can add spinach, tomatoes, or even some fried sausages to enrich the flavor of your omelette.
- How can I store the omelette?
If you have leftover omelette, you can store it in the refrigerator in an airtight container, and the next day you can reheat it in a skillet or microwave.
- Is the potato omelette suitable for those on a diet?
Yes, as long as you are mindful of portions and choose healthier ingredients, such as olive oil and low-fat cheese.
